Preparation Steps
- Preheat your oven to 425°F (220°C). Prepare two baking sheets with non-stick aluminum foil or parchment paper.
- Spread diced sweet potatoes across the baking sheets in a single layer. Drizzle with olive oil, season with salt and pepper, and roast for about 30 minutes, stirring halfway through.
- In a large skillet over medium heat, fry the chopped bacon until crispy for about 8–10 minutes. Drain on paper towels.
- In the same skillet, sauté the diced bell peppers over medium heat for 5–7 minutes until softened and lightly golden.
- In a large mixing bowl, combine roasted sweet potatoes, sautéed peppers, pineapple, chives, and parsley. Toss gently to mix.
- Blend the shallot, ginger, jalapeño, chipotle powder, chili powder, kosher salt, lime zest, lime juice, and honey in a blender until smooth. Gradually add olive oil while blending.
- Drizzle dressing over the salad ingredients and mix gently. Crumble the crispy bacon on top, adjusting seasonings for taste.

Notes
Ensure to cut sweet potatoes into uniform pieces for even roasting. For extra texture, consider adding toasted nuts or seeds.
